Lee Newman (born 1 May 1973) is a Welsh male athlete who competes in the shot put and discus events.
After retiring from sports, Newman built a successful career in Private Equity running multi-national companies.
[1] Newman competed in the discus event at the 1998 Commonwealth Games in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ia finishing 7th and competed in both the discus and shot put events at the 2002 Commonwealth Games in Manchester, England finishing 8th and 11th respectively.
[2][3] He has won three bronze medals at British championships, two in the shot put in 1994 and 1999 and one in the discus in 1999.
